Description
Technical Field
The invention relates to a seed metering device in agricultural machinery, in particular to a seed metering device which can adapt to various types of seeds.
Background
Crop or other crop seeds can generally be classified as either granular or non-granular. The existing seed metering devices in various seed sowing machines are generally designed according to granular seeds, and the seed metering devices can be used for continuously and uniformly discharging the granular seeds ideally. For non-granular seeds, such as seeds of some Chinese herbal medicines (eucommia seeds and the like), the ideal discharge of the existing various seed metering devices is difficult to realize. At present, for non-granular seeds, the adopted sowing mode is artificial sowing, and thus the defects are that: the labor intensity is high, the sowing uniformity is poor, and the production efficiency is low.

Detailed Description
The invention is further described below with reference to examples and figures.
See fig. 1, 2, 3 and 4
The invention provides a multi-type seed sowing device which is provided with a seed box 3, wherein the bottom of the seed box 3 is provided with a seed outlet 3a, the outer side of the bottom of the seed box 3 is connected with a sleeve 2, the sleeve 2 is provided with a seed inlet 2a, and the seed inlet 2a is connected with the seed outlet 3 a. A seed shaft 1 is arranged in the sleeve 2, a spiral blade 4 is fixed on the outer surface of the seed shaft 1, and two ends of the seed shaft 1 extend out of the sleeve 2. The sleeve 2 is provided with a group of seed discharging ports 2b, and the parts of the seed box 3 above the seed discharging ports 2b are respectively and correspondingly fixed with a shield 5, and the shield 5 surrounds the outer sides of the seed discharging shaft 1 and the blades 4 and shields the seed discharging ports 2b from above.
In this embodiment, bearings 6 are respectively mounted at two ends of the sleeve 2, and two ends of the seed shaft 1 are respectively supported by the bearings 6 disposed at two ends of the sleeve 2.
